Michele A. Raykovich

ELKHORN – Michele A. Raykovich, age 73, passed away unexpectedly on Friday, April 11, 2025 at Aurora Lakeland Medical Center in Elkhorn.  She was born on September 26, 1951 in Detroit, MI to Harold and Evelyn (DePetro) Pierce.  Michele was united in marriage to Jeffrey M. Raykovich on August 9, 1975 in Birmingham, MI.  Michele started her career in public schools in Michigan before moving to Wisconsin and teaching at St. Mary’s Catholic School in Pewaukee.  They briefly returned to Michigan and Michele taught at St. Patrick Elementary School in Carleton before coming back to Wisconsin and teaching at St. Andrews Catholic School starting in 1991.  Michele was lovingly known by her students as the “Snickers Queen”.  Michele retired after 27 years at St. Andrews.  When Michele was asked about getting licensed as an administrator she said “I don’t want to be in an office.  I want to be with the kids.”  She was involved with St. Andrews as a 1st Communion instructor and also volunteered at the Tree House in Elkhorn.         

Michele is survived by her husband, Jeff; a daughter, Andrea Raykovich, of Waterford; a son, Nick (Emily) Raykovich, of Madison; granddaughter, Signe, of Madison; a brother, Harold Jr. (Nancy) Pierce, of New Boston, MI; and nieces and nephew, Ivy, Stephanie, Katie, and Sean.

Michele is preceded in death by her parents and a sister, Andrea Vogt.
